Fire involving lorry trailer on M62 motorway

Date published: 20 August 2012


At 3:30am on 18 August two engines, from Heywood and Blackley fire stations, were called to a lorry on fire on the M62 motorway between junctions 21 and 22.

When they arrived the crews found a fire involving a refrigerated HGV trailer, which they extinguished using hosereels while wearing breathing apparatus. The crews also used ladders to access the trailer and a thermal imaging camera to ensure the spread of the fire.

The fire is thought to have started when sparks from a tyre which had burst spread to the trailer.
